Welcome to THE DUPONT, a brand-new, master-planned Tridel community nestled in Toronto's vibrant Dupont Cultural Corridor. This brand new spacious 1-Bedroom + Den, 2-Full Bath suite features a functional, open-concept floor plan designed for modern living.Suite Features:Primary Retreat: Generous primary bedroom with a designer closet with ample space and a stylish 4-piece ensuite bathroom .Versatile Den & 2nd Bath: Large, flexible den space ideal for a home office, paired with a full second 3-piece bathroom complete with a walk-in tiled shower.Modern Kitchen & Finishes: Designer kitchen featuring integrated energy-efficient appliances, stone countertops, premium cabinetry, and in-suite laundry.Building Amenities:Residents enjoy over 16,000 sq. ft. of world-class resort-style amenities, including:Outdoor swimming pool, sun deck, BBQ dining terrace, and fireside lounges.State-of-the-art fitness center, yoga/wellness studio, sauna, and steam rooms.Sophisticated party room, games lounge, and a dedicated kids' play area.Prime Location:Steps away from transit (minutes to Ossington Subway Station), trendy local cafes, gourmet dining, art galleries, and everyday conveniences. Apartment homes in Toronto (Dovercourt-Wallace Emerson-Junction) took a median of 29 days to sell over the last 90 days, with the quickest quarter selling within 16 days and the slowest quarter taking more than 52, across 3,017 recorded sales.
That clock counts only the listing each home finally sold on. Measured from the first time these properties came to market, including any earlier listings that were withdrawn and re-entered, the median is 55 days.
The median sale price was $574,900.
Homes sold for about 3.2% below asking on average, so there was room to negotiate.
About 12% of sales closed above the list price.
Around 19% of sellers reduced their price before finding a buyer.
Based on 3,017 recorded sales in the last 90 days. Aggregate statistics only; individual sale prices are not shown.
